Alice Cooper, join the party!
With U.S. Presidential frontrunners Hillary Clinton and Donald Trump both facing high disapproval rates, Cooper believes he is the man for the job.

The 68-year-old musician is running with the slogan: “A Troubled Man for Troubled Times”.
You would believe the artist could muster some serious support from his fan base, but a look at his campaign website reveals he is not overly serious about the candidacy.

He calls for late Motorhead frontman Lemmy’s likeness to be added to Mount Rushmore – and for comedian Groucho Marx to be immortalized on the $50 bill. Cooper’s campaign consists of selling merchandise and reissuing his band’s 1972 song “Elected”.
The prospect of President Cooper may seem unlikely, but hey – it looks like anything is possible this election.
